A recent warning from Michael Saylor, co-founder of MicroStrategy, has shaken the Bitcoin community. Saylor claims that the biggest risks to Bitcoin are not from external sources, like potential quantum computing threats, but from internal protocol changes that could destabilize the network.
Saylor emphasized the need for protocol ossification to shield Bitcoinโs structure. He stated that consistent internal updates could lead to unexpected vulnerabilities. This statement has drawn mixed reactions from the crypto community, as many are skeptical.
One commenter pointed out, "Can an ossified coin jump? Not looking promising." Others are concerned that the market dynamics have shifted significantly.
"The market isnโt the same anymore," stated one participant, reflecting broader concerns about crypto volatility influenced by geopolitical risks and quantum threats.
Coinbase is responding to these concerns by establishing an independent advisory board focusing on quantum security. Their aim is to assess risks and provide solutions for the evolving threats that could undermine Bitcoin's cryptographic foundations.
The crypto industry is increasingly recognizing quantum computing's potential to breach existing security measures. Coinbase's move indicates a proactive approach as the conversation surrounding quantum risk enters the mainstream.
